# Data Alchemist ๐Ÿงช

A sophisticated Next.js application for managing and analyzing complex data relationships between clients, workers, and tasks. Built with TypeScript, Tailwind CSS, and modern React patterns, featuring AI-powered filtering and intelligent data validation.

## ๐Ÿ—๏ธ Architecture

### Tech Stack
- **Framework**: Next.js 15.3.4 with App Router and Turbopack for fast development
- **Language**: TypeScript 5+ with strict type checking and comprehensive interfaces
- **Styling**: Tailwind CSS 4.1.11 with custom components and responsive design
- **UI Components**: Radix UI primitives with custom styling and accessibility features
- **State Management**: React hooks with local storage persistence and session restoration
- **Animations**: Framer Motion for smooth interactions and micro-animations
- **File Processing**: ExcelJS, PapaParse, JSZip for comprehensive data import/export
- **AI Integration**: OpenRouter API with Claude 3 Haiku for natural language processing
- **Data Validation**: Custom validation engine with real-time field-level feedback

### Data Flow Architecture
1. **File Upload** โ†’ CSV/Excel parsing โ†’ Entity type detection โ†’ Validation engine
2. **AI Filtering** โ†’ Natural language processing โ†’ Expression generation โ†’ Data filtering
3. **Rule Management** โ†’ AI parsing or manual builder โ†’ Rule validation โ†’ Priority ordering
4. **Data Export** โ†’ Entity selection โ†’ Format choice โ†’ File generation โ†’ Download

## ๐Ÿš€ Getting Started

### Prerequisites
- Node.js 18+ with npm, yarn, or pnpm
- Modern web browser with JavaScript enabled
- Optional: OpenRouter API key for enhanced AI features

### Installation

1. **Clone the repository**
```bash
git clone
cd data-alchemist
```

2. **Install dependencies**
```bash
npm install
# or
yarn install
# or
pnpm install
```

3. **Environment Setup (Optional)**
```bash
# Create .env.local for AI features
echo "OPENROUTER_API_KEY=your_api_key_here" > .env.local
```

4. **Start the development server**
```bash
npm run dev
# or
yarn dev
# or
pnpm dev
```

5. **Open the application**
Navigate to [http://localhost:3000](http://localhost:3000) in your browser.

## ๐Ÿ”ง Configuration

### Data Validation Rules
The system supports comprehensive validation for:

#### Clients
- **ClientID**: Required, unique, format validation with duplicate detection
- **ClientName**: Required field with non-empty validation
- **PriorityLevel**: Integer 1-5 range validation with bounds checking
- **RequestedTaskIDs**: Comma-separated task ID format (T1,T2,T3) with pattern matching
- **GroupTag**: Enum validation (GroupA, GroupB, GroupC) with predefined values
- **AttributesJSON**: JSON format validation with syntax checking

#### Workers
- **WorkerID**: Required, unique identifier with duplication prevention
- **WorkerName**: Required field with length validation
- **QualificationLevel**: Integer 1-10 range with skill level validation
- **Skills**: Comma-separated or array format with skill tag validation
- **AvailableSlots**: Array of phase numbers [1,3,5] with range checking
- **MaxLoadPerPhase**: Positive integer validation with capacity limits
- **WorkerGroup**: Non-empty string validation with group membership

#### Tasks
- **TaskID**: Required, unique identifier with format validation
- **TaskName**: Required field with descriptive content validation
- **Category**: Required category classification with predefined options
- **Duration**: Positive integer (number of phases โ‰ฅ1) with timeline validation
- **RequiredSkills**: Comma-separated skill tags with skill database validation
- **MaxConcurrent**: Positive integer for parallel assignments with resource limits
- **PreferredPhases**: Range syntax (1-3) or array [2,4,5] with phase validation

## ๐Ÿ”Œ API Endpoints

### `/api/filter-expression`
- **Method**: POST
- **Purpose**: Converts natural language queries to JavaScript filter expressions
- **Parameters**:
- `query`: Natural language filter description
- `entityType`: Target data type (client/worker/task)
- `data`: Sample data for context (optional)
- **Response**: JSON with expression string and metadata
- **Error Handling**: Comprehensive error messages with suggestions

### `/api/parse-rule`
- **Method**: POST
- **Purpose**: Parses and validates business rule definitions
- **Parameters**:
- `ruleText`: Natural language rule description
- `entityType`: Applicable entity type
- **Response**: Structured rule object with type classification
- **AI Integration**: Uses Claude 3 Haiku for intelligent parsing
